State-Level Lawful Variant: A Patchwork System

There is actually no singular “OnlyFans law” in the United States. Instead, policies intersect with more comprehensive legal types including adult material, online protection, work distinction, and also buyer defense.

Some states adopt a fairly permissive posture, centering mostly on grow older restrictions and taxes. Others offer stricter rules relating to adult satisfied distribution, verification requirements, or even system obligation.

For example, conditions like The golden state usually tend to manage electronic systems via consumer personal privacy as well as data defense structures like the California Customer Personal Privacy Act (CCPA). These regulations do certainly not directly target OnlyFans, but they determine how the system takes care of customer records and declarations.

On the other hand, conservative-leaning conditions including Utah as well as Louisiana have actually taken more specific measures toward moderating accessibility to adult-oriented sites through obligatory age proof laws. These rules usually call for systems organizing certain forms of material to implement identity look for consumers, switching compliance problems onto firms as opposed to internet service providers.

Age Verification Regulations as well as Digital Access

One of one of the most substantial developments influencing OnlyFans consumption through condition is the increase old confirmation laws. These laws are actually generally created to avoid smalls coming from accessing adult content online, yet their range often stretches broadly to systems holding user-generated material.

States like Louisiana have enacted laws needing websites which contain a specific percent of adult material to verify individuals’ grows older by means of government-issued identification or even 3rd party proof units. Comparable legal proposals have actually been questioned or applied in states like Texas as well as Arkansas.

These regulations have a double impact. On one palm, they aim to enhance on the web protection and lower direct exposure of minors to improper material. Alternatively, movie critics say that they elevate privacy problems, raise information safety and security threats, as well as produce barricades for adult users that might not desire to submit sensitive recognition to get access to content.

For systems like OnlyFans, which currently call for identification confirmation for designers, additional user-side verification regulations launch operational complication. They also raise questions regarding data storage space, cybersecurity dangers, and compliance prices.

Taxation as well as Economic Distinction

An additional significant measurement of “OnlyFans by condition” is taxation. Despite area, revenue produced by means of OnlyFans is actually generally considered taxable self-employment profit in the USA. Nonetheless, conditions vary in revenue tax obligation costs, mentioning demands, and also enforcement intensity.

Conditions without profit tax, including Fla or Texas, may be monetarily valuable for creators compared to high-tax conditions like California or New York. However, even in low-tax states, creators should still follow government tax commitments, featuring self-employment tax obligation and also quarterly approximated payments.

In addition, category of makers as independent contractors rather than employees implies they are accountable for handling their own rebates, business expenses, and retirement life payments. This category continues to be consistent throughout conditions yet engages in different ways with local tax bodies.
